Strong Financial Performance:
- TenableTENB-- reported 11% year-over-year revenue growth, with a 36% unlevered free cash flow margin in Q1 2025.
- The growth was driven by the success of Tenable One, which led to accelerated new sales, particularly with seven-figure wins.

Public Sector Uncertainty:
- The revised guidance reflects a two-thirds decrease in the U.S. public sector contribution, affecting CCB guidance.
- This reduction is due to less visibility and disruption from personnel changes in the federal government, leading to longer lead times for procurement decisions.

Tenable One and Cloud Security Momentum:
- Tenable One contributed over 30% of new business sales, with significant growth in cloud security adoption.
- The integration of cloud security and exposure management is a critical pillar, driven by large multi-cloud environments and compliance pressures.

Vulcan Cyber Acquisition Impact:
- While the Vulcan acquisition contributed 0.5 point to growth in Q1, its full impact is expected in the latter half of the year, once new capabilities are integrated.
- The acquisition brings third-party data integration and remediation capabilities, creating opportunities for platform expansion and displacement of competitors.
